Explore the foundational ideology behind modern China in "Political Doctrines of Sun Yat-Sen: An Exposition of the San Min Chu I." Authored by Paul Myron Anthony Linebarger, this volume delves into the core principles of the "San Min Chu I" - the Three Principles of the People - as articulated by Sun Yat-sen, the father of the Chinese Revolution.

Gain insight into Sun Yat-sen's political philosophy and its profound impact on Chinese history. This exposition provides a clear understanding of Nationalism, Democracy, and People's Livelihood, the tenets that shaped Sun's vision for a unified and prosperous China.

A crucial resource for understanding the intellectual underpinnings of 20th-century Chinese politics, this book offers invaluable context for students, historians, and anyone interested in the forces that shaped contemporary China.
